Social Communication Groups

Building Social Skills Through play and fun in Brisbane and Redlands.

Perfect for children who struggle with friendships, turn-taking, or understanding social situations. Our social communication groups help children aged 3-18 years develop essential interpersonal skills.

Who Benefits:

Children with autism or social communication differences

Kids who struggle to make or maintain friendships

Children who have difficulty with turn-taking or sharing

Those who misread social cues or situations

Kids with anxiety in social settings

What We Work On:

Play Skills: Joint attention, imaginative play, game rules

Conversation Skills: Starting, maintaining, ending conversations

Perspective Taking: Understanding others' thoughts and feelings

Problem Solving: Navigating social conflicts

Non-Verbal Communication: Body language, personal space

LEGO® Therapy Program

LEGO® Therapy Groups

Using the motivating power of LEGO® to build communication, collaboration, and social skills. Perfect for children who love building and creating.

Social Communication Groups 3

The LEGO® Therapy Method:

Developed by Dr. Daniel LeGoff, this evidence-based approach uses children's natural interest in LEGO® to develop:

Social communication

Team collaboration

Problem-solving skills

Flexibility and compromise

Joint attention and sharing

How It Works
How It Works:

Children work in pairs or small teams with assigned roles:

  • Engineer: Has the instructions, gives verbal directions
  • Builder: Builds according to engineer's instructions
  • Supplier: Finds and supplies correct pieces
  • Director: Oversees and supports the team

Roles rotate each session, ensuring every child practices different skills.

Food Explorer Program

Feeding Groups for Fussy Eaters in Brisbane

A fun, pressure-free group approach to expanding children's diets. Using the SOS Approach principles  and Responsive feeding strategies, in a social setting.

Food Explorer Program

Food Explorer Program

Perfect For:

Fussy eaters with limited diets

Children anxious about new foods

Kids who eat differently than peers

Those struggling with school lunchboxes

Children motivated by peer modeling

Session Activities
Program Structure:

Each session explores foods through play and sensory experiences using SOS and Responsive Feeding principles.

Key Principles:

  • No pressure to eat
  • Exploration at child's pace
  • Peer modeling and support
  • Sensory-friendly approach
  • Parent education included

Hanen More Than Words® Program

For parents of children with autism or social communication delays

This intensive 8-week program teaches you to:

  • Follow your child's lead
  • Build interaction through play
  • Develop communication in everyday routines
  • Support understanding and expression
  • Use visual supports effectively

Key Word Sign Training

Supporting early communication through gesture

Learn 100+ signs to:

  • Augment communication while speech develops
  • Reduce frustration for late talkers
  • Support children with developmental delays
  • Enhance all children's understanding and expression of language.

Parent Feeding Workshop

Strategies for fussy eaters

One-day intensive or 4 x 60min sessions covering:

  • Understanding food selectivity and challenges
  • Reducing mealtime pressure
  • Food chaining techniques
  • Managing difficult behaviors
  • Creating positive food environments
